Abstract

A method, a system, and computer readable medium comprising instructions for real-time monitoring of agent adherence. The method comprises collecting events and data for an agent from at least one phone router, collecting time keeping data from a time clock system, collecting data and events from a scheduling system, normalizing the events, data, and generating at least one user interface comprising normalized data, presenting at least one view of the at least one user interface to at least one application, and refreshing the at least one view with updated events and data.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the phone skill that the agent is currently taking calls for is also referred to as a working skill and wherein a phone skill name that the agent is currently scheduled to take calls for is also referred to as a scheduled skill.

3. The method of claim 2 , wherein non-adherence by the agent is indicated when the working skill differs from the scheduled skill.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the scheduling system generates at least one schedule for an agent.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ein normalizing the events, data, time keeping data comprises computing the event, data, and time keeping data in a high performance computing server.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one view comprises at least one level of display, wherein the at least one level of display includes a display of details across a plurality of sites, a display of details for a particular site, a display of details for a particular skill, and a display of details for a particular agent.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the adherence percentage is calculated by dividing the number of agents who are in adherence over the number of total agents and multiplying the result by 100.

8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the number of agents who are in adherence is calculated by subtracting the number of agents who are out of adherence from the number of total agents.
